Guilty Gear Strive is a fighting game published by Arc System Works that originally came out in 2021. Now we have sight of the latest character added to the game, as well as some other patch notes for the popular fighting game.

Bedman? is one of the characters who is already featured in the story, so fans will already be aware of them. They are one of the players included in the season pass, so you will need the DLC in order to access the player.

alongside the new character being introduced we also have sight of other changes and balances being introduced that you can read about below.

Guilty Gear Strive patch notes 1.26 general

  • Added “Bedman?” as a playable character.
  • Added avatar items for “Bedman?”.
  • Added new BGM to the gallery mode.
  • Digitial Figure: Added items for Sin Kiske.
  • GG World: Added new glossary terms related to Another Story. Updated the entries for Sin Kiske, Delilah, Baiken, Faust, Bedman, and May.

Guilty Gear Strive patch notes 1.26 network mode

  • Fixed an error where the Search ID would be displayed darkened out when creating a Player Match room with the room type set to Training.
  • Enhanced countermeasures against unauthorised network signals.

Guilty Gear Strive patch notes 1.26 battle

  • Roman Cancel will now activate on either hit or whiff of the attack, regardless of the input method. It is no longer possible to input Roman Cancel in such a way that it will only activate when the attack whiffs.
  • Clash: The slow-down effect now ends when a clash occurs between two characters’ attacks.
  • Input Priority: Air backdash now has higher priority than air dash. An air backdash will now be executed rather than an air dash when quickly releasing backwards after inputting backwards + dash button.
  • Wall Stick: Fixed an error where the character’s position would sometimes change when triggering wall stick in the corner under certain conditions.
  • Fixed minor visual issues during battle.

Guilty Gear Strive patch notes 1.26 character balance

Potemkin

  • Slide Head: Can now K.O. the opponent when it triggers Wall Break.

Faust

  • Scarecrow (S version): Fixed an error where Faust’s position relative to the opponent after the move would sometimes vary between the left and right side of the screen under certain conditions. Faust’s positioning now remains the same regardless of the direction faced.

Zato-1

  • Amorphous: The hitbox will now always activate in front of the stage corner.

Ramlethal Valentine

  • Bajoneto (all versions): Fixed an error where the sword would sometimes move to an unintended position under certain conditions.

Leo Whitefang

  • Dash: Can now be overwritten with Faultless Defense when input during a super flash.

Giovanna

  • Dash: Can now be overwritten with Faultless Defense when input during a super flash.

Anji Mito

  • Kachoufuugetsu Kai: The super flash now initiates as soon as the counter is successful. The time before the super flash has been reduced as it was possible with some moves to act in between the counter succeeding and the super flash.

I-No

  • Air dash, Air back dash: The input buffer window timing and activation conditions are now consistent with other characters.

Happy Chaos

  • Fire: Now always makes contact with the opponent when they are taking damage or in block stun. Fixed an error where Fire could be used directly after At the Ready (HS) under certain conditions. It is no longer possible to use Fire directly after the freeze on activation of Roman Cancel, etc.
  • Super Focus: Can now perform At the Ready (HS) directly after this move when activated with zero Concentration.

Sin Kiske

  • Hawk Baker: The start up of Hawk Baker’s follow up can no longer be Roman Canceled. It remains possible to follow-up with Gazelle Step as well as Roman Cancel when the opponent is taking damage or blocking.
